**Runbook: Escalating Pagination Issues — Lanternfish Public API**

If customers report broken cursors or duplicate pages after a release, don't roll back immediately — first check whether the `next_cursor` encoding changed between versions, since that's the usual culprit. Grab a sample request, note the API version header, and confirm against staging. If staging reproduces it, the release is suspect and you should halt the rollout train. For anything ambiguous, ping the API platform escalation inbox.

pager mailbox: quenael@zemvarsys.internal

For future maintainers: the Corvid vault storing TLS material for our health-check endpoints sealed itself after the Ashworth datacenter power event. Until it is unsealed, the load balancer in the Bramblegate pool cannot verify backend health probes, so it is failing open and routing to possibly unhealthy nodes. Do not restart the balancer — that makes it fail closed instead. Unseal the vault first, then re-run the probe verifier. To unseal, enter the recovery passphrase below.

unlock words, kajeg-fahif: holmir-casael-novdor

Heads up, sales leads — leadership has opened early talks about acquiring Quillbeam Analytics, the small forecasting shop out of Marlow Bay. Nothing is signed, and honestly it could still fall apart, so don't hint at it in customer calls. If it goes through, their Tidepool engine would slot nicely under our Meridian suite and plug the gap competitors keep poking at. Keep pipeline notes neutral for now; no bundled pricing chatter. The thinking behind the move is summarized directly below.

management briefing: Jorixax Holdings is in early talks to buy Casixax Holdings for about $420.3 million. The Fenmir launch date is October 27, and nothing goes to the press before then. Legal wants the Keloxek Foods term sheet redrafted before April 16.

Ticket: Staging env misconfigured for Siftgate bloom filter

The bloom layer in front of the Pellet KV store is rejecting all lookups in staging because the env file was copied from the dev template without credentials. False-positive tuning values are fine; only the auth line is missing. To unblock the weekly demo, the Pellet admission secret must be set on the following line.

env line for yaguf-fajop: LEDGER_TOKEN13=fb08984397349